The attachments should now be rendered using `{attachment slug}` instead
of `@[slug]`. The `link` attribute can be specified in the shortcode
(for attachments that support it), rather than in the attachment itself.
The attachment subdocument is now reduced to `{oid: File ObjectID}`, and
nodes without attachments should NOT have an `attachment` property at
all (previously it would be an empty dict). This makes querying for
nodes with/out attachments easier.
The CLI command `upgrade_attachment_schema` can do dry-run and remove
empty attachments:
- Added --go to actually perform the database changes.
- Remove empty attachments, so that a node either has one or more
attachments or no attachments sub-document at all.
The CLI command `upgrade_attachment_usage` converts `@[slug]` to
`{attachment slug}`. It also takes into account 'link' and 'link_custom'
fields on the attachment. After conversion those fields are removed from
the attachment itself.

The YouTube shortcode supports various ways to refer to a video:
- `{youtube VideoID}`
- `{youtube youtube.com or youtu.be URL}`
URLs containing an '=' should be quoted, or otherwise the shortcodes
library will parse it as "key=value" pair.
The IFrame shortcode supports the `cap` and `nocap` attributes. `cap`
indicates the required capability the user should have in order to
render the tag. If `nocap` is given, its contents are shown as a message
to users who do not have this tag; without it, the iframe is silently
hidden.
`{iframe src='https://source' cap='subscriber' nocap='Subscribe to view'}`

By default CSRF protection is disabled for all views, since most
web endpoints and all API endpoints do not need it.
On the views that require it, we use the
current_app.csrf.protect() method.

This is done via coercion rules. To cache the field 'content' in the
database, include this in your Eve schema:
{'content': {'type': 'string', 'coerce': 'markdown'},
'_content_html': {'type': 'string'}}
The `_content_html` field will be filled automatically when saving the
document via Eve.
To display the cached HTML, and fall back to display-time rendering if it
is not there, use `{{ document | markdowned('content') }}` in your template.

@manager.option also registers the function as command, so the double use
is generally unnecessary.
Furthermore, @manager.command will register CLI options based on the
function parameters, which potentially conflict with the ones registered
with the following @manager.options decorators.
Note that positional arguments should be given in reverse order.
